If you're fairly confident on your bike and ready to broaden your cycling horizons, our Steady rides are ideal. At a comfortable pace, and possibly with some modest hills along the way, rides take place on mainly quiet roads with plenty of sights along the way. Rides are between 6 and 20 miles long, at a moderate pace of between 7 and 10 miles an hour. This is a scenic ride giving views of the River Orwell and River Stour estuaries. You will see the Royal Hospital School and Erwarton Hall, a Tudor mansion where Anne Boleyn is reputed to have stayed frequently and the church where she is said to have left instructions for her heart to be buried. Indeed in the 19th century a heart shaped casket was found in the walls and respectfully reinterred there. There is a field which usually contains Alpacas and a farmhouse which keeps peacocks. The 20 mile route is undulating but none of the climbs are very long though a couple will perhaps raise your heart rate a little! A good ride for anyone wanting to test themselves and move on from the shorter Sky Rides and really enjoy the experience of a group ride.
